Garcinia cambogia has become considerable attention in recent years as a potential weight loss supplement. This tropical fruit, native to Southeast Asia, contains a compound called hydroxycitric acid (HCA), which is thought to play a role in appetite suppression and fat breakdown. Studies suggest that HCA may assist in reducing body weight and fat mass, possibly by blocking the production of citrate lyase, an enzyme involved in fat synthesis.

Additionally, Garcinia cambogia is reported to increase serotonin levels in the brain, which can elevate mood and minimize cravings for sugary foods. However, it's important to note that research on Garcinia cambogia is still limited. More studies are needed to confirm its long-term impact and potential side effects.
